⚡ Common Causes of Charger Port Issues

  1. Loose or Damaged Port
    Over time, frequent plugging and unplugging can loosen the port or cause internal damage.
  2. Faulty Charger or Cable
    Sometimes, the problem isn’t with the port at all — a worn-out or frayed charging cable can prevent proper power flow.
  3. Battery Problems
    If the battery is failing, your laptop may not recognize the charger, even if the port is fine.
  4. Software/Driver Issues
    Power management settings or outdated drivers can block charging.
  5. Motherboard Damage
    In more serious cases, internal components connected to the charging port may have failed.

🛠️ Quick Fixes to Try

Before assuming the worst, try these steps:

  • Check the Charger: Test with another Lenovo-compatible charger to rule out a faulty adapter.
  • Inspect the Port: Look for dirt, dust, or visible damage. Use compressed air to gently clean it.
  • Power Reset: Shut down your laptop, unplug everything, and hold the power button for 30 seconds. Plug back in and restart.
  • Update Power Drivers: Go to Device Manager > Batteries > Update Drivers.
  • Test Without the Battery: If your model allows, remove the battery and plug in the charger. If it powers on, the battery may be the culprit.

🚨 When Professional Repair is Needed

If the port feels loose, has burn marks, or none of the fixes above work, it’s likely a hardware issue. In most cases, this means replacing the charging port, which requires professional tools and expertise.
